The Ngorongoro Conservation Area is widely recognised as one of Africa's longest-standing experiments in multiple land-use promoting both natural resource conservation and pastoral development in northern Tanzania. This book provides a case study of management in the Ngorongoro Conservation Area and details the background studies and planning processes used to develop a conservation and development strategy as well as a general management plan for the area.
